Definitions

filchpast participle
Stolen; taken in a stealthy or casual manner.
The police recovered the filched artwork within hours.
filchverb
To steal something, especially something of small value, in a casual or sneaky manner.
She managed to filch a few coins from the jar when no one was looking.
